According to some users When you upgrade OpenOffice.org from Synpatic on PC/OS. OpenOffice.org breaks. It wont start and it wont. Deleting the preferences folder in the home directory doesnt do anything, uninstalling and reinstalling doesnt do anything. Do not update OpenOffice until the issue is figured out and if you did you will have to download the OpenOffice 2.4 package from http://pc-os.org/downloads.html and use that one.

This behavior has been verified by myself and it can be replicated in Ubuntu 8.04 and has been reported to Canonical.
